Do you have any major regrets?<br />

No. I regret that when I came in as<br />

president [of the Screen Actors Guild], I<br />

wasn’t more versed in the intricacies of<br />

running a union, of knowing how to play<br />

the union. I did a lot of running fast, but<br />

I’m still learning.<br />

What new project(s) do you have<br />

coming up?<br />

Well, I do two shows: “A Man and His<br />

Prostate,” which Ed Weinberger wrote,<br />

which is always successful. Joe Proctor<br />

and Samuel Warren wrote a fine piece<br />

called “God Help Us,” in which I play<br />

God. It involves a man and a woman<br />

who have been lovers in the past, but<br />

who disagree intensely with each other’s<br />

positions; one is a fascist and one is an<br />

extreme liberal. So those promote well<br />

and show well. These are good times for<br />

political jokes, and they are well written.<br />

You are pretty busy these days,<br />

correct?<br />

Not really. I tour with two different<br />

shows. But before the holidays, the<br />

phones are off. It’ll pick up after the New<br />

Year.<br />

What are some of your favorite<br />

charities and causes?<br />

I feel very strongly about environmental<br />

organizations. Defenders of Wildlife<br />

is my chief activity; I’m on the board.<br />

I’m supportive wherever I can be or<br />

whenever I have the money, or any<br />

peace effort in the Middle East. I was<br />

very saddened at the [pull out] by the<br />

United States from the Iran nuclear<br />

agreement and knew it would happen<br />

once Trump took in John Bolton as<br />

an adviser. So other than wildlife and<br />

Central American issues that I can<br />

contribute to, and the union of course,<br />

that’s about the only activity I can<br />

register.<br />
